March 30 2026
After a cold weekend with below average temp's, mild weather conditions are expected for the next couple of days with the temperature reaching into the 60's along with rain. The release from the dam is 1750cfs and Pineville gauge is around 2050cfs as of this morning. It was another day of mixed reports from anglers depending on where they fished. Some anglers fished here on the main river, while others went to some of the smaller local tributaries. The upper end of the river in Altmar continues to have the best water clarity and the least amount of runoff and is where the majority of bank anglers are going. The drift boats are taking advantage of the higher flows while covering lots of water. With the higher flows the fish will be holding in the softer water along the edges and inside seams. For those anglers who are fly fishing, anglers have had success dead drifting with nymphs, using egg patterns under a strike indicator or swinging small streamers with sink tips. For those anglers who are float fishing or bottom bouncing, egg sacs, beads and pink worms have produced the best results.
